Cost Breakdown: MBBS Degree in Poland - Fees & Expenses

Pursuing an MBBS degree in Poland offers a reasonably beneficial financial option for international scholars . The overall cost structure is typically lower than in quite a few Western regions. Annual tuition payments typically fall between €4,000 and €7,000 , depending on the institution and the program's specific requirements . Beyond tuition, daily costs – including accommodation , nourishment, commuting, and incidental expenditures – can vary from €500 to €800 each month. Therefore, the approximate annual cost to study medicine in Poland, apart from travel and entry submissions, sits around €10,000 to €15,000 . Note that these are merely projections, and actual charges can change .

    MBBS in Poland: Total Cost, Living Expenses & Hidden Fees

    Pursuing an MBBS in Poland is increasingly a popular option for aspiring doctors , but understanding the total cost is vital . While program expenses are usually less expensive than in many other nations, the complete financial outlay involves more than just that. Accommodation expenses, nourishment, travel , study materials , and entertainment all contribute to the regular daily budget. In addition , it’s critical to be mindful of potential hidden fees , such as permit renewals , healthcare plans, and registration charges . A realistic budget should anticipate around roughly €5,000 to €8,000 per twelve months for general expenses, alongside the tuition fee . Careful research and preparation are vital to sidestep financial surprises .
